Comprehending IELTS in Uzbekistan
The IELTS is recognized by over 10,000 organizations worldwide, consisting of universities, employers, and immigration authorities. In Uzbekistan, the test is administered by different recognized centers that provide prospects with the opportunity to take either the Academic or General Training versions of the IELTS.
The test consists of four elements: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. Each element is developed to measure a candidate's efficiency in English and is scored on a band scale of 0 to 9.

Preparation is vital for success in the IELTS. Here are some efficient techniques to help candidates prepare much better:
Understand the Test Format: Familiarize yourself with the structure of the Ielts Exam Fee Uzbekistan test, including the kinds of questions in each section.
Practice Regularly: Utilize practice tests offered through various online resources and books specifically designed for IELTS preparation.
Take Preparation Courses: Consider registering in coaching centers that use specialized IELTS preparation courses tailored to Uzbekistan's academic environment.
Enhance English Skills: Engage in daily English speaking, listening, reading, and composing activities. This could include enjoying English-language media, reading books, or speaking with proficient speakers.
What to Expect on Test Day
On the test day, candidates need to be gotten ready for the following:
Identification: Bring an initial, legitimate passport or national identity card.Arrival Time: Arrive at the test place a minimum of 30 minutes prior to the scheduled time.Evaluating Conditions: Candidates must stick to stringent screening policies, including silence and keeping the stability of the test materials.

1. How do I register for the IELTS test in Uzbekistan?
Prospects can sign up for the IELTS test online through the British Council website or directly through the test center's official website. It is advisable to register well in advance, as spots can fill up rapidly.

3. The length of time are Ielts Uzbekistan Test Venue ratings legitimate?
IELTS scores stand for 2 years. After this period, prospects may need to retake the test if they need to provide proof of their English language proficiency.
4. Can I alter my test date after registering?
Yes, candidates can alter their test date, but this typically sustains a charge and must be done a minimum of 5 weeks before the initial test date. Talk to the test center for specific policies.
5. What should I do if I need special lodgings?
If you need special accommodations due to medical conditions or specials needs, inform the test center well in advance of your test date to guarantee suitable plans can be made.
